What’s the Opportunity?

Anchor QEA is seeking a Staff-level Environmental Scientist to support multidisciplinary projects focused on climate resilience, nature-based solutions, beneficial use of dredged material, ecological restoration, and community-centered environmental outcomes. This position supports applied science, planning, and implementation projects across coastal, estuarine, and riverine systems.

You will support senior staff in planning, coordinating, and implementing restoration and resilience projects, contributing to project planning activities, field efforts, data synthesis, reporting, and collaboration with interdisciplinary teams in a collaborative, science-driven consulting environment.

Responsibilities

Specific responsibilities of this position include the following:

  • Support planning, design, and implementation of ecological restoration and climate resilience projects, including living shorelines, habitat restoration, green infrastructure, and water quality improvement efforts.
  • Assist with coordination of multidisciplinary project teams, including scientists, engineers, planners, contractors, and agency partners.
  • Support development of work plans, scopes, schedules, and budgets under the guidance of senior staff.
  • Participate in field activities such as site assessments, habitat monitoring, data collection, and construction oversight support as needed.
  • Compile, manage, and synthesize environmental, biological, and physical data to support technical analyses.
  • Support preparation of technical memoranda, reports, client proposals, graphics, and summaries.
  • Assist with permitting and regulatory coordination activities, including development of permit applications, for restoration and resilience projects.
  • Contribute to stakeholder and community engagement efforts, including meeting preparation and coordination.
  • Assist with grant tracking, reporting, and documentation for federally and state-funded projects, as needed.
